Transaction 63feb5a262048532739f46e86d736dde446ab6b734ccd4eccd9ec01481124318
1 Input
1 Output
-
63feb5a262048532739f46e86d736dde446ab6b734ccd4eccd9ec01481124318:0
- value
- 270373
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b89831874fe72d57a2c98e7e08cff4e8b82eb18f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hq3etJc6dEHeBe39LNFA7HzwwkWBcxjWK